Parole Sweep Nets 4 Arrests In Menifee

All four were booked into the Southwest Detention Center in French Valley.

Four people were back behind bars after being arrested in Menifee on suspicion of violating parole, authorities said.

Deputies assigned to the Menifee Police Department's Special Enforcement Team conducted a series of probation and parole compliance checks Wednesday and ended up arresting the four suspects, who are all from Menifee.

They are:
